from Tampa Date Reviewed: March 20, 2006 | | Favorite Trail: | reddick in ocala | | Duration Product Used: | 1 Year | | Price Paid: |
$376.00 | | Purchased At: | ebay | | Strengths: | price. durability, peddaling effeciency, | | Weaknesses: | front end can be twitchy at slow speeds, rims could be better, wtb seat didnt last long | | Similar Products Used: | specialized stump jumper. kona stinky, kona dawg deluxe | | Bike Setup: | all stock except marzocchi z1 alloy and a new seat | | Bottom Line: | i love this bike it has gotten me through everythin florida can throw at it with out a hitch, we might not have the crazziest drops but its still a tough bike. the only thing that ever broke was the ti rails on the seat. this bike also handles flawlessly once you get used to it. it. it needs to be pushed to get the best performance out of it but this might be because of my longer forks. all in all though this is a great bike and i enjoy it more than other $2000 bikes | Value Rating: Overall Rating: |

from rochester,ny Date Reviewed: January 25, 2006 | | Favorite Trail: | old forge,ny trail system | | Duration Product Used: | 2 Years | | Price Paid: |
$399.00 | | Purchased At: | dick's sporting good/new return | | Strengths: | price, excellent mixture of components, came from factory with diffent components than listed above. i'm 6'1", 225 lbs 50+ years old and put 1200 -1500 miles a year on this bike with 2 major tuneup in that time. | | Weaknesses: | only weakness was mavic rims and spokes having to be trued several times, have now changed to ritchey zero dish and eliminated that problem. | | Similar Products Used: | department store mountain bikes | | Bike Setup: | 27 speed shimano deore,wtb rocket v seat,raceface prodigy stem and seatpost,raceface low riser bar,ritchey zerodish wheels,wtb weirwolf tires, sram 970 cassette,raceface prodigy chainrings, manitou axel comp fork and shimano 520 clipless pedals and shoes | | Bottom Line: | this bike handles all terrain i covered with it with only a couple of minor problems with mavic wheels frame well made, light weight for the money, bought as a discounted new return because a bike shop told consumer wasnt a good bike.. lucky me hasnt stranded me any place in 2 plus years I will replace with another mongoose pro bike when i have to | Value Rating: Overall Rating: |
